Syria to allow UN probe of alleged nuclear site


Jun 2, 4:43 PM (ET)

By GEORGE JAHN


VIENNA, Austria (AP) - Syria will allow in U.N. inspectors to probe allegations that a remote building destroyed in an Israeli airstrike was a nuclear reactor built secretly with North Korean help, the International Atomic Energy Agency said Monday.

The invitation signaled the start of an international fact check of U.S. and Israeli assertions that Damascus had tried to build a plutonium-producing facility under the radar of the international community.
